A Denison man is facing legal troubles-including felony theft-following what authorities say was his unwillingness to pay for a motorcycle he agreed to purchase from a Holton resident.
Holton Police Chief Gale Gakle says the case began when Holton resident Wayne Dodd reported the non-payment, and missing bike, later traced to Jefferson County(Play Audio :24 seconds)
Gakle says the suspect, identified as Sheldon Massey, was arrested, and now faces a number of charges(Play Audio :14 seconds)
Following the investigation, and arrest, Dodd is reunited with the motorcycle.
However, authorities say the case is a good example of why a sales transaction should be finalized prior to allowing the buyer to make off with the goods.
